Platform Transformation Director - Ingress
Wejo Ltd.
An interim contract role with the world's leading connected car marketplace. Responsible for transforming the delivery of all data ingest, data management and development of the data platform based on a combination of Kafka, Spark, Scala and S3 storage from AWS.
Key Achievements
• Led the on-boarding and technical delivery of new mobility data providers onto the platform - giving a total of over 17m vehicles and over 17Bn transactions a day into the platform. Peak load equates to around 650k transactions per second.
• Responsible for the transformation of the end-to-end delivery of all Ingress data pipelines, taking connected car data from our partners, loading and reconciling before persisting it in a common data model to support a variety of data products for monetisation.

• Envisioned, designed and implemented the Customer SPINE, a Data Management Strategy and associated platform to enable the more effective management of "customer" and "service" data across Cable & Wireless Worldwide and Energis Communications
• Proposed and implemented an operational analytics solution to drive more effective Customer Service provision. Resulted in a data driven process that increased on-time Service Delivery from 72% to over 90% by providing a focus on those tasks that directly affected On-time Service Delivery.
• Implemented an "Opportunity to Cash" solution showing corporate revenue leakage down the sales, order, delivery and invoicing lifecycle. Allowed the sales teams to become more efficient during the sales process, resulted in greater lead conversion and improved service delivery processes.
